Berit Mørland is a scholar working on Economics and Econometrics, General Health Professions and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health. According to data from OpenAlex, Berit Mørland has authored 36 papers receiving a total of 431 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 11 papers in Economics and Econometrics, 9 papers in General Health Professions and 8 papers in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health. Recurrent topics in Berit Mørland’s work include Health Systems, Economic Evaluations, Quality of Life (10 papers), Healthcare cost, quality, practices (5 papers) and Pharmaceutical Economics and Policy (4 papers). Berit Mørland is often cited by papers focused on Health Systems, Economic Evaluations, Quality of Life (10 papers), Healthcare cost, quality, practices (5 papers) and Pharmaceutical Economics and Policy (4 papers). Berit Mørland collaborates with scholars based in Norway, United Kingdom and Spain. Berit Mørland's co-authors include Gilla Kaplan, Jørg Mørland, Hans R. Preus, John‐Arne Røttingen, Marianne Klemp, Katrine Frønsdal, Alf Inge Smievoll, Tore Midtvedt, Inger Natvig Norderhaug and Lise Lund Håheim and has published in prestigious journals such as The Lancet, Infection and Immunity and Experimental Cell Research.
